commercetools-sdk-php-v2  master
The platform, import-api and ml-api PHP sdks generated from our api reference.
Address.php
1 <?php
2 
3 declare(strict_types=1);
10 
14 
15 interface Address extends JsonObject
16 {
17  public const FIELD_ID = 'id';
18  public const FIELD_KEY = 'key';
19  public const FIELD_TITLE = 'title';
20  public const FIELD_SALUTATION = 'salutation';
21  public const FIELD_FIRST_NAME = 'firstName';
22  public const FIELD_LAST_NAME = 'lastName';
23  public const FIELD_STREET_NAME = 'streetName';
24  public const FIELD_STREET_NUMBER = 'streetNumber';
25  public const FIELD_ADDITIONAL_STREET_INFO = 'additionalStreetInfo';
26  public const FIELD_POSTAL_CODE = 'postalCode';
27  public const FIELD_CITY = 'city';
28  public const FIELD_REGION = 'region';
29  public const FIELD_STATE = 'state';
30  public const FIELD_COUNTRY = 'country';
31  public const FIELD_COMPANY = 'company';
32  public const FIELD_DEPARTMENT = 'department';
33  public const FIELD_BUILDING = 'building';
34  public const FIELD_APARTMENT = 'apartment';
35  public const FIELD_P_O_BOX = 'pOBox';
36  public const FIELD_PHONE = 'phone';
37  public const FIELD_MOBILE = 'mobile';
38  public const FIELD_EMAIL = 'email';
39  public const FIELD_FAX = 'fax';
40  public const FIELD_ADDITIONAL_ADDRESS_INFO = 'additionalAddressInfo';
41  public const FIELD_EXTERNAL_ID = 'externalId';
42  public const FIELD_CUSTOM = 'custom';
43 
48  public function getId();
49 
54  public function getKey();
55 
60  public function getTitle();
61 
66  public function getSalutation();
67 
72  public function getFirstName();
73 
78  public function getLastName();
79 
84  public function getStreetName();
85 
90  public function getStreetNumber();
91 
96  public function getAdditionalStreetInfo();
97 
102  public function getPostalCode();
103 
108  public function getCity();
109 
114  public function getRegion();
115 
120  public function getState();
121 
128  public function getCountry();
129 
134  public function getCompany();
135 
140  public function getDepartment();
141 
146  public function getBuilding();
147 
152  public function getApartment();
153 
158  public function getPOBox();
159 
164  public function getPhone();
165 
170  public function getMobile();
171 
176  public function getEmail();
177 
182  public function getFax();
183 
188  public function getAdditionalAddressInfo();
189 
194  public function getExternalId();
195 
202  public function getCustom();
203 
207  public function setId(?string $id): void;
208 
212  public function setKey(?string $key): void;
213 
217  public function setTitle(?string $title): void;
218 
222  public function setSalutation(?string $salutation): void;
223 
227  public function setFirstName(?string $firstName): void;
228 
232  public function setLastName(?string $lastName): void;
233 
237  public function setStreetName(?string $streetName): void;
238 
242  public function setStreetNumber(?string $streetNumber): void;
243 
247  public function setAdditionalStreetInfo(?string $additionalStreetInfo): void;
248 
252  public function setPostalCode(?string $postalCode): void;
253 
257  public function setCity(?string $city): void;
258 
262  public function setRegion(?string $region): void;
263 
267  public function setState(?string $state): void;
268 
272  public function setCountry(?string $country): void;
273 
277  public function setCompany(?string $company): void;
278 
282  public function setDepartment(?string $department): void;
283 
287  public function setBuilding(?string $building): void;
288 
292  public function setApartment(?string $apartment): void;
293 
297  public function setPOBox(?string $pOBox): void;
298 
302  public function setPhone(?string $phone): void;
303 
307  public function setMobile(?string $mobile): void;
308 
312  public function setEmail(?string $email): void;
313 
317  public function setFax(?string $fax): void;
318 
322  public function setAdditionalAddressInfo(?string $additionalAddressInfo): void;
323 
327  public function setExternalId(?string $externalId): void;
328 
332  public function setCustom(?Custom $custom): void;
333 }
setAdditionalStreetInfo(?string $additionalStreetInfo)
setAdditionalAddressInfo(?string $additionalAddressInfo)